What is the first exam going to look like?

0

The first two pages of the exam will contain essay questions addressing your understanding of general systems, systems problems, and aspects of the COSO framework. There will also be a question about how hierarchical block diagramming might apply to the cases we discussed in class. You do not have to memorize the cases. If you need a specific case during the exam, I will allow you to refer to it. There will also be approximately forty-five to fifty MCs (the systems basics practice quiz in TechTutor(tm) contains some general examples.) with a lot of emphasis on the questions we discussed in class, the material covered in the book, lessons learned from the cases we analyzed, and the teaching notes.
